#509365 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#509365 is composed of 31.4% red, 57.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 44.5%. #509365 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ffca with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#509365 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#509365 has RGB values of R:80, G:147,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5280613.

Shades and Tints of #509365
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040705 is the darkest color, while #fafc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#509365
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a796f is the less saturated color, while #01e248 is the most saturated one.
